Mongolia

Mongolia, which is bordered by Russia and China, has numerous rivers, some draining into the Arctic Ocean, others into the Pacific. The Selenge River is the largest river in both Russia and Mongolia and traverses close to one thousand kilometers before draining into Lake Baikal.The Mongol Empire was established by Genghis Khan in the twelve hundreds and in the sixteenth and seventeenth centuries the country became, in large part, Tibetan Buddhist. It came under strong Russian and Chinese influence in the early twentieth century until in 1924, the Mongolian People's Republic was formed. At the end of the century the country transitioned to a market economy. It is the most sparsely populated independent country in the world.
